Bulletin 700-RTC — Solid-State Timing Relay
- Timing functions
- 8 ON-delay
- 8 OFF-delay
- Timing ranges
- Seconds: 0.05…2, 0.2…8, 0.4…30, 2…120
- Minutes: 0.015…1, 0.06…4, 0.25…16 and 1…64
- AC, 50/60 Hz or DC
- 600V AC maximum
- 300V DC maximum
- Relays with fixed time delay
- Sealed contacts
- Harsh environments
- Hazardous locations Class I, Div. 2, Groups A, B, C and D

Bulletin 700-RTC Relays with Fixed Time Delay— Relays with Provision for Instantaneous Contacts
Relays listed below have slots for two timed and two instantaneous contacts. Unused slots are equipped with removable dummy cartridges.
| Digit | Operating Mode | Fixed Time Delay |
| S | On-Delay s | Seconds Two digits indicating the fixed time delay in seconds. Three digits indicating the fixed time delay (first digit indicates seconds, next two digits indicate 1/100 seconds). |
| Z | Off-Delay s | |
| Y | On-Delay Min. | Minutes Two digits indicating the fixed time delay in minutes. Three digits indicating the fixed time delay (first digit indicates minutes, next two digits indicate 1/100 minutes). |
| I | Off-Delay Min. | |
Examples: Cat. No. 700-RTC00Y200U1 is for a relay without contact cartridges. Y20 indicates an On-Delay timer with a 20 minute fixed time delay. This is a standard relay. Order the contact cartridges separately. Cat. No. 700-RTC42S020U1 is for a relay with 2 N.O. cartridges in the timed position and 1 N.C. cartridge in the instantaneous position. S02 indicates an On-Delay timer with a 2 second fixed time delay.

Specifications
Voltage and Power Requirements
| AC Voltage +10% 15% 50/60 Hz |
Total Power Required | Initiate Terminal Power | Maximum Allowable Leakage Current |
Coil Code |
| 24V AC | 8 VA | 4 VA | 10 mA | U24 |
| 110/120V AC | 9 VA | 4 VA | 2.4 mA | U1 |
| DC Voltage +10% 20% |
Total Power Required | Initiate Terminal Power | Maximum Allowable Leakage Current |
Coil Code |
| 24V DC | 10 W | 5 W | 10 mA | U24 |
| 120V DC | 11 W | 5 W | 2.4 mA | U1 |
| Type | 700-RTC | |
| Contact Rating (See pub. 700-SG003*) |
NEMA B600 600V AC, 5 A NEMA P300 300V DC, 5 A |
|
| Contact Arrangement | 1…4 poles. Max. of 2 timed and 2 instantaneous. Available in any combination of N.O. and N.C. contacts |
|
| Contact Material | W (tungsten in a controlled gas atmosphere) | |
| Operating Mode | Convertible to ON-Delay or OFF-Delay | |
| Timing Range | 0.05…64 min. | |
| Reset Time | 25 ms | |
| Repeat Accuracy | ±1% (or ±50 ms) at constant voltage and temperature | |
| Mounting | Panel or strip mount | |
| Surge Suppression | Not required. Timers have internal suppression | |
| Certifications | UL Listed, File E10314, Guide NOIV, CSA Certified, File LR11924 Suitable for use in Class I, Division 2, Groups A, B, C, and D |
|
| Maximum Allowable Leakage Current | 24V AC/DC | 10 mA |
| 110/120V AC, 120V DC |
2.4 mA | |
| Ambient Temperature⋆ | ||
| Operating: | 20…+60 °C (4…+140 °F) | |
| Storage: | 20…+60 °C (4…+140 °F) | |
| ⋆ Continuous duty units placed close to each other (3 in a row) have a temperature range of 20…+45 °C (4…+113 °F) or should have air circulated around the units. Approximate space of 3/4 in (mm) on all sides is needed. | ||
